Pinnacle award for best customer experience of 2020

Posted: July 9, 2020

Someren Glen was recently awarded the 2020 Customer Experience Award from Pinnacle Quality Insight. This honor is awarded to the top 10% Skilled Nursing Communities in the United States. Only 14 communities in Metro Denver were awarded Pinnacle’s Best in Class Customer Service Awards. We are proud to be one of them.

Best In Class Senior Healthcare Services for 2020

Someren Glen’s Skilled Nursing community qualified for this distinguished award in the categories of Dignity and Respect and Recommend to Others based on our continued dedication to providing Best in Class senior healthcare services.

Throughout our 40-year history of serving the Metropolitan Denver area, Someren Glen has placed a strong emphasis on ensuring that the individual needs of every resident are met. Over the course of 2019, a sampling of guests, residents, and their families have participated in monthly telephone interviews that include open-ended questions, as well the opportunity to rate us in specific categories.

Additionally, Someren Glen polls residents on the quality of their lives in their neighborhoods each month through the Pinnacle organization. We ask about the basics of dining and housekeeping, always working to keep these standards high. However, what matters most to us is the quality of our relationships with people. Our Leadership Team reads each survey for signs that reaffirm our extraordinary commitment to those we serve and to our core values of respect and compassion, as well as to look for ways we can improve.

What is Pinnacle Quality Insight?

By qualifying for the Pinnacle Customer Experience Award Someren Glen has satisfied the rigorous demand of scoring in the top 15% of the nation across a 12-month average.

A customer satisfaction measurement firm with 24 years of experience in post-acute healthcare, Pinnacle conducts over 150,000 phone surveys each year and works with more than 2,500 care providers in all 50 US states, Canada and Puerto Rico.
